After anticipated affirmative action ruling, Black leaders speak out

After the U.S. Supreme Courtroom did what many have lengthy anticipated, strike-down race-based admissions to high schools, Black leaders held emergency press conferences and technique calls. One convened by Marc Morial on June 29 hours after the Supreme Courtroom’s determination yielded sharp commentary.

Affirmative motion refers to a set of insurance policies and practices aimed toward selling equal alternatives for traditionally deprived teams, significantly in relation to employment or training. The aim of affirmative motion is to deal with the historic and ongoing systemic discrimination and underrepresentation that has been confronted all through historical past. Girls, racial and ethnic minorities, and people with disabilities have been beneficiaries. Sometimes, affirmative motion includes taking proactive steps to extend the illustration of those underrepresented teams in areas the place they’ve been traditionally excluded or marginalized.

The 6-3 ruling by the U.S. Supreme Courtroom will alter school admissions insurance policies. Chief Justice John G. Roberts Jr., writing the opinion for almost all, stated the packages “unavoidably make use of race in a detrimental method” and “contain racial stereotyping,” in violation of the Structure.  The ruling affirmed that race-conscious admissions packages at Harvard and the College of North Carolina are unconstitutional.

Affiliate Justice Sonia Sotomayor spoke in particular person her dissent from the bench which signaled sturdy disagreement saying the courtroom’s ruling “additional entrenching racial inequality in training” can have a devastating affect.”

The choice would appear to be a slap within the face of historical past in addition to actual world actuality. At present, a transfer is on to ban books in lots of college districts throughout America with many Republicans calling rudimentary dialogue on race “divisive.” Statistics on school enrollment for African People show there may be extra work to be achieved to extend enrollment at a time when school prices have skyrocketed.

“I discover it attention-grabbing to say we’re past race on this nation once we know that 48 p.c of white college students admitted to Harvard between 2009 and 2014 both have been legacy admissions or they have been athletes,” stated Maya Wiley, President of the Management Convention on Civil and Human Rights.

“That is the primary time that we face a courtroom that misinterpreted the equal safety clause and our seminal case Brown vs. Board of Training after a predecessor courtroom made very clear what the principals have been within the Structure and within the Brown case,” stated Janai Nelson, President of the NAACP Authorized Protection Fund throughout a mid-day press occasion held by the Nationwide City League.

The NAACP Authorized Protection Fund has been concerned in each case involving affirmative motion that has gone to the U.S. Supreme Courtroom.

“Sadly, this Supreme Courtroom is attempting to have a actuality that’s extra reflective of 1950,” stated NAACP President Derrick Johnson.

“Immediately’s case, let’s be very clear, doesn’t finish Affirmative Motion but it surely makes it far more tough. It narrows the flexibility of upper training establishments to make use of their very own energy to resolve who must be in a classroom… we’re not abandoning the battle,” Nelson concluded.

“Pals as we speak the Supreme Courtroom bought it improper. I believe today will stay in infamy. As a result of it was probably the most tortured opinions any of us have ever seen as a result of it’s twisted by way of its logic on the regulation,” Damon Hewitt, President of the Legal professionals Committee for Civil Rights Below Regulation.

“Nothing within the opinion stops universities from asking about their race,” Hewit identified. “Our recommendation to college students is to proceed to speak about your experiences with race and racism,” he concluded.

“This Supreme Courtroom ruling will shut the door to academic alternative for a lot of Black college students and college students of colour who need to attend non-HBCUs. With this new ruling, UNCF is aware of that extra college students will flip to HBCUs for his or her school educations.  We additionally know that our HBCUs will do every thing they’ll to fulfill elevated pupil demand,” said a press launch from the United Negro School Fund.
